# Disabling the OTG mode to use a keyboard and mouse again
|
||||
|
||||
**WARNING: Untested**
|
||||
1. Comment out the dwg2 line in `/boot/firmware/config.txt` using a `#` in front of the line
|
||||
```
|
||||
[all]
|
||||
#dtoverlay=dwg2
|
||||
```
|
||||
1. Comment out the dwg2 line in `/etc/modules` using a `#` in front of the line
|
||||
```
|
||||
#dwg2
|
||||
```
|
||||
1. Disable the gadget service
|
||||
```
|
||||
systemctl disable serial-ether-gadget.service
|
||||
```
|
||||
1. Disable the getty
|
||||
```
|
||||
systemctl disable serial-getty@ttyGS0.service
|
||||
```
